GitHub Actions Artifacts
If you want to try out the absolute latest features before they are even released to the nightly-auto release, you can download build artifacts directly from GitHub Actions.
Artifacts are files generated during the build process of every commit. They are stored for a limited time (usually 90 days).
How to Download Artifacts
- Go to the Push Workflow page on GitHub.
- Click on the latest workflow run with a green checkmark.
- Scroll down to the Artifacts section at the bottom of the page.
- Click on the
.zipfile for your browser (e.g.,tabliss-chromium,tabliss-firefox, ortabliss-safari) to download it.
GitHub Account Required
You must be logged into a GitHub account to download artifacts directly from the Actions tab.
If you don't have an account or can't log in: You can use nightly.link to download the latest artifacts without a GitHub account.

Which artifact to choose?
- For Chrome, Edge, and Brave, use
tabliss-chromium. - For Firefox, use
tabliss-firefox. - For Safari, use
tabliss-safari.
